Book Synopsis To Find a Wolf by : Stephanie Jetton

Download or read book To Find a Wolf written by Stephanie Jetton and published by Xlibris Corporation. This book was released on 2009-08-18 with total page 149 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Jorge is searching for his lost love. His ranch is in ruins and his friends are dead. He tries to forget his green eyed beauty, but something compels him; something huge. Her trail leads to a hotel, but she is gone without a trace. India is on the run. Shes determined to leave behind the cattle ranch, she had destroyed. The man she tried to forget haunted her. When her cousin sends her a letter from the hotel she left, something compels her to return. However, when she returns to the hotel the old worry quickly turns into bitter resentment
